The Issue

Thousands of Gmail users across the globe love Gmail for its sneak-peek feature and use it on a daily basis. Unfortunately, Google discontinued this feature without warning on May 30, 2013.

Below is a quote from "jellyneck" explaining the importance of this feature.
"Please bring it back. There is simply no other way to quickly scan an email without opening it. Using the preview pane marks it as read which means I have to take additional steps to mark it as unread again so I can revisit it later when I have time.
For me, unread emails signify something to be addressed when I have more time. And read emails mean that I am addressing it in some fashion. By previewing emails, it allows me to decide if it's something that can be addressed very quickly or if I will leave it for later (ie leave it unread).

If the preview pane is the only way now to preview an email, it's likely going to lead to missed emails because I have to manually mark it as unread (ie to be addressed later when I have more time). I'm sure I'm going to forget to mark some as unread because of the added step.

Perhaps a win-win would be to add "quick preview" to the new rt-click menu (in addition to archive/delete/read/unread). What do you say? Please? Pretty please???"
